Myth 1: All Screens Are Scratch-Proof Nowadays

Fact:
Most modern smartphones come with Gorilla Glass or Ceramic Shield, which are scratch-resistant—but not scratch-proof. Coins, keys, and even sand can still scratch your screen. A screen protector adds an extra layer of defense and absorbs damage before it reaches your actual screen.


Myth 2: Tempered Glass Protectors Shatter Easily

Fact:
Tempered glass is designed to break—so your phone screen doesn’t have to. When dropped, the protector absorbs the impact and cracks, leaving your actual screen untouched. It’s much cheaper to replace a protector than a full display.


Myth 3: Screen Protectors Reduce Touch Sensitivity

Fact:
While this was true with older or low-quality protectors, modern screen protectors are ultra-thin and built to maintain 100% touch sensitivity—even with fingerprint sensors and Face ID compatibility. Brands like ESR, Spigen, and Belkin are known for high sensitivity and clarity.


Myth 4: They Ruin the Look of Your Phone

Fact:
You can now get edge-to-edge, ultra-clear, anti-fingerprint, and even matte-finish protectors that blend so well with your screen, you won’t even notice them. Plus, they help avoid smudges and offer anti-glare properties for better visibility outdoors.


Myth 5: Screen Protectors Aren’t Necessary if You Have a Case

Fact:
Even the best cases don’t cover the entire screen surface. A phone can still fall flat on its face. Using both a case and a screen protector gives your phone 360° protection, especially against face-down drops.
